BBFC: Sega compiling Sonic games for DS

According to the rating, it'll feature Sonic 1-3, plus Sonic and Knuckles -- with the ability to virtually "Lock-on" and play as Knuckles in the older games. Also included in the shockingly specific list of in-game content: Sonic Chronicles and "The History of Sonic" video content and the art gallery.
We can only hope it turns out better than Sonic the Hedgehog Genesis on GBA.
